Pool Return Line Leaks: Symptoms, Testing & Repair Decisions
The short answer
A leaking pool return line may cause faster water loss while the pump runs, a wet area near the deck, or soil movement with no visible equipment leak. Because underground water can travel away from the break, the correct sequence is to isolate and pressure-test the line, pinpoint the failure, and only then plan access.

What a Pool Return Line Does
Return lines carry filtered water from the equipment pad back to the pool through wall fittings, floor returns, spa jets, or water features. When the pump is running, these pipes are under positive pressure. A split pipe, failed glue joint, or damaged fitting can release water into the surrounding soil every day the system operates.
Texas wet-and-dry cycles put buried rigid PVC under repeated stress. The vulnerable point is not always the pipe itself; joints, tees, and the connection behind a return fitting can fail while everything visible at the pad stays dry.

Signs That Raise Suspicion
No single symptom proves a return-line leak. A useful pattern is measured water loss that increases during circulation, especially when a particular feature or group of returns is active. Damp soil, settling pavers, or a washed-out area can support the suspicion, but water may follow the plumbing trench and appear several feet from the source.
- Water loss is measurably greater with the pump running
- One return circuit or water feature changes the rate
- The equipment pad is dry despite continuing loss
- Deck joints open, pavers settle, or nearby soil stays unusually damp
- A return fitting shows a gap or draws dye during an underwater test
Isolation Before Excavation
A technician plugs the pool openings, isolates each circuit, and applies controlled test pressure while watching a calibrated gauge. A line that cannot hold is investigated further; a line that holds helps narrow the search to other plumbing or the pool interior.
Electronic listening, tracer gas, and targeted probing can help locate escaping pressure beneath a deck. Site conditions affect which method works best. Reinforced concrete, deep lines, and saturated soil change how sound travels, so experienced interpretation matters as much as the instrument.
Fitting Leak or Buried Pipe?
A failed seal at the return fitting may be accessible from inside the full pool and may not require deck removal. A confirmed break several feet back from the wall usually requires targeted access from above or beside the line. That distinction is why dye inspection and pressure testing belong together.
Avoid sealing every visible return as a blanket fix. A surface patch cannot repair a separated joint underground, and unnecessary sealant can make the eventual repair harder. The repair should match the confirmed failure.
Repair Planning in San Antonio and Central Texas
Around San Antonio and New Braunfels, clay, caliche, and limestone can make excavation highly variable from one yard to the next. Precise location limits deck cuts and reduces disturbance, particularly where lines pass beneath coping, patios, or landscaping.
After repair, the circuit should be pressure-tested again before the access area is closed. That verification is the clean finish to the process: confirmed failed, repaired, then confirmed tight.
